Maximizing Climate Control in Greenhouses with Large Exhaust Fans

Jun 19,2026

In the world of greenhouse operations, maintaining the ideal climate is crucial for maximizing plant growth and productivity. One of the most effective tools for achieving this is the large greenhouse exhaust fan. These fans are designed to facilitate proper air circulation, helping to control temperature and humidity levels within the greenhouse.
Firstly, large greenhouse exhaust fans play a vital role in temperature regulation. During hot weather, greenhouses can easily become overheated, which can stress plants and inhibit growth. By installing large exhaust fans, you can efficiently expel hot air from the greenhouse, allowing cooler air to enter. This process not only helps in maintaining optimal temperatures but also ensures that plants receive the right amount of fresh air, which is essential for photosynthesis.
In addition to temperature control, large greenhouse exhaust fans are critical for managing humidity levels. High humidity can create a breeding ground for diseases and pests, adversely affecting plant health. By promoting proper air exchange, these exhaust fans help lower humidity levels, reducing the risk of mold and mildew. This is especially important in densely planted areas, where air circulation may be limited.
Another significant advantage of large greenhouse exhaust fans is their capacity to improve air quality. Stagnant air can lead to the buildup of carbon dioxide and other gases that are detrimental to plant growth. These fans help to remove stale air and replace it with fresh air, ensuring that plants have access to the necessary gases for optimal growth and development. Moreover, by maintaining healthy air quality, you can support a more resilient plant cultivation environment.
When considering the implementation of large greenhouse exhaust fans, it is essential to assess the size and design of your greenhouse. The fan's capacity should be matched with the greenhouse’s volume to ensure efficient air exchange. Factors such as fan placement, orientation, and the use of multiple fans should also be taken into account to achieve a balanced airflow. Utilizing exhaust fans in conjunction with intake fans can create a more effective ventilation system, further enhancing climate control.
In conclusion, large greenhouse exhaust fans are indispensable for any greenhouse aiming for optimal climate management. By regulating temperature, controlling humidity, and ensuring good air quality, these fans contribute significantly to the health and productivity of your plants.
